I have completed a few of these mini builds and loved them. This one on other hand.. not my favorite. I got the Sweet Talk set. It looked super cute. A lot of the paper pieces are TINY! Some have to be glued on top of like cardboard then cut out. You definitely need some sharp teeny tiny scissors. I had 2 wood pieces that were not the correct size that had to be cut and sanded. The wood pieces for the stand, were not the same size so it sits funny. It does say in the instructions “small deviation among different batch of wood material is inevitable pls understand.” That’s the exact wording. But still.. the pieces should at least match up. The instructions were not terrible. I’ve seen worse. Some of the items I just found impossible to make per their instructions. The teeny tiny little cupcake holders? Super hard to cut out and fold correctly. Also, the donut things with the twisted twine or whatever it is. Didn’t work. I made my own out of clay. I originally thought “oh this will be easy. It looks more like a beginner’s set.” I don’t think so. Quality? It’s not terrible. Not the greatest though. Value for money? Not bad if you want a cheaper kit to do. My advice? To make this set, get some super small scissors, tweezers and a magnifying glass if you can’t see well.
